
Kimberly is a passion-driven writer looking for her niche in the world of writing. Not yet willing to commit to one genre she is dabbling in all of them. A writer since she was 15, Kimberly began her writing career through a journal. Overcoming a life filled with adversity only made Kimberly a more determined person. A born Canadian through and through Kimberly spent most of her life in Northern Ontario in the small town of Sault Ste. Marie, where she was raised by her mother. She is spending her time raising her daughter and writing her novels. When she is not writing Kimberly has a passion for new adventures and learning new things. Known as a Jack-of-all-trades this passion has found her flying airplanes, learning guitar, dabbling in photography, hairstyling as well as working as a personal trainer where she taught women to exercise through the art of pole dancing. An experienced woman Kimberly has brought her experiences to her writing. She is now looking for her next adventure.
Her first published work was a short story The Unusual Suspects published by The Drive Magazine in April 2007. She recently published her first novel Mirror Of Who You Were due for release June 20th 2009 by PublishAmerica, LLC. She has also signed a second contract for her next novel entitled Memoirs Of A Gibson. The first a love story with characters that won't leave you long after reading and the second a comedy memoir told through the eyes of a Gibson guitar.
Kimberly finds her inspiration not only through life experiences but through her love of books and movies. She gets her taste for romance through such movies as The Notebook, Nottinghill and Gone With The Wind. Her all time favourite movies tie in her love for adventure, Top Gun and Jurassic Park. She's inspired by such writer's as Jodi Picoult and Nicolas Sparks.
